英文摘要 | This paper describes the electrochemical properties of reduced graphene sheets (rgss) for the electrocatalytic properties towards the hydrazine oxidation in alkaline media. the rgss have been produced in high yield by a soft chemistry route involving graphite oxidation, ultrasonic exfoliation, and chemical reduction. the rgss possess excellent electrocatalytic activity towards the hydrazine oxidation. in our opinion, rgss are a potential electrode material for direct hydrazine fuel cells and electrochemical sensors for hydrazine detection.
